Pierre–Michel Huet is a scholar working on Hepatology, Epidemiology and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, Pierre–Michel Huet has authored 87 papers receiving a total of 3.7k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 60 papers in Hepatology, 56 papers in Epidemiology and 29 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in Pierre–Michel Huet's work include Liver Disease and Transplantation (55 papers), Liver Disease Diagnosis and Treatment (54 papers) and Organ Transplantation Techniques and Outcomes (21 papers). Pierre–Michel Huet is often cited by papers focused on Liver Disease and Transplantation (55 papers), Liver Disease Diagnosis and Treatment (54 papers) and Organ Transplantation Techniques and Outcomes (21 papers). Pierre–Michel Huet collaborates with scholars based in Canada, France and United Kingdom. Pierre–Michel Huet's co-authors include Jean‐Pierre Villeneuve, Albert Tran, Gilles Pomier–Layrargues, Denis Marleau, France Varin, Rodolphe Anty, A Viallet, Marielle Gascon‐Barré, Jean Gugenheim and Philippe Gual and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Clinical Investigation, Gastroenterology and Circulation Research.
